Replacing Spreadsheet Reporting for Sage 200 Users
Many organisations using Sage 200 rely on spreadsheets to produce their management reports. While Sage 200 is effective at capturing financial and operational data, many businesses find that analysing this information in a flexible way often requires exporting it into Excel.
In the early stages, this approach works well. Finance teams can extract data from Sage 200, build spreadsheets and create reports tailored to the needs of the business. Excel provides flexibility and allows reports to be adjusted quickly as requirements change.
However, as the business grows, spreadsheet reporting often becomes more complex.
More transactions, more customers and more products mean that more data must be analysed. What started as a simple spreadsheet can evolve into a large and complicated reporting model containing multiple worksheets, formulas and pivot tables.
Each reporting cycle then requires the same process to be repeated. Data must be exported from Sage 200, imported into spreadsheets and carefully checked before the reports can be finalised.
Over time, these spreadsheets can become difficult to manage. Changes to the structure of the business may require updates to formulas or report layouts. New reporting requirements can lead to additional spreadsheets being created, increasing the overall complexity of the reporting process.
Another challenge is that spreadsheet reporting often becomes dependent on one individual. The person who originally built the reporting spreadsheets usually understands how they work, but it can be difficult for others to maintain or update them without that knowledge.
There is also the risk of errors. When data is exported and manipulated manually, mistakes can easily occur. Because spreadsheets can contain large numbers of formulas, these errors are not always immediately visible.
In addition, spreadsheet reporting typically produces static reports based on historical data. By the time reports have been prepared and distributed, the information may already be out of date.
For organisations that want more timely and reliable insight, replacing spreadsheet reporting becomes an important step.
Automated reporting systems provide a more effective approach. Instead of exporting data and rebuilding reports manually, information can be extracted directly from Sage 200 and transformed into structured management reports.
This allows reports to be generated automatically and updated as new data is recorded, giving management teams access to up-to-date information whenever they need it.
